Indian Motorcycle Forum banner
lake geneva
1-1 of 1 Results
  1. Indian Scout
    In this picture, you see the shore of Lake Geneva Switzerland with the city of Lausanne, the photo is taken from Evian (you know the water) France @ the Crossroad, the very old train station, Petite Rive - Maxilly This is THE start ! Route des Grandes Alpes, from Thonon les Bains to Nice...
1-1 of 1 Results